CE Certification for Gabion Fences Ensuring Quality and Compliance


Gabion fences have become increasingly popular in modern landscape architecture and civil engineering due to their unique blend of aesthetics, sustainability, and structural integrity. These wire mesh containers filled with stones or other fill materials not only serve as effective retaining walls but also provide sound barriers, wildlife habitats, and decorative elements in gardens and parks. However, to ensure that gabion fences meet the necessary safety and quality standards in the European market, CE certification plays a crucial role.


Understanding CE Certification


CE marking signifies that a product complies with the essential requirements of relevant European Union directives and regulations. For construction products, including gabion fences, this certification indicates that the product has been tested and meets the standards for health, safety, and environmental protection established by the EU. The CE marking facilitates the free movement of goods in the European market by assuring consumers and traders of product quality.


The Importance of CE Certification for Gabion Fences


1. Quality Assurance CE certification provides assurance that gabion fences have undergone rigorous testing and meet established performance standards. This helps prevent inferior products from entering the market, ensuring that consumers receive high-quality fencing solutions.


2. Compliance with Regulations In Europe, manufacturers are legally required to obtain CE certification for construction products. This compliance is crucial not only for market access but also for adhering to safety regulations, which protect both the public and the environment. Manufacturers without CE certification may face legal repercussions or restrictions in selling their products.


3. Consumer Confidence The CE mark is a visible indicator of safety and reliability. Consumers often look for this certification when choosing building materials, as it provides peace of mind regarding the performance and durability of the product. CE-certified gabion fences are more likely to be preferred by homeowners, contractors, and landscape architects.


4. Environmental Sustainability Many gabion fences are made from natural materials, making them an environmentally friendly choice. CE certification often includes assessments of the environmental impact of the product, encouraging manufacturers to adopt sustainable practices in their production processes and thereby contributing to greener construction.

The CE Certification Process for Gabion Fences


To achieve CE certification for gabion fences, manufacturers must follow several steps


1. Determine the Relevant Standards Manufacturers must identify the appropriate European standards that apply to gabion fences. These standards establish the performance and safety requirements for various applications.


2. Testing and Evaluation Products must undergo testing by accredited testing bodies to assess their compliance with the selected standards. This may include evaluations of structural integrity, durability, and environmental impact.


3. Certificate of Conformity Once testing is successfully completed, a Declaration of Performance (DoP) can be issued. This document outlines the performance characteristics of the product and affirms its compliance with the relevant standards.


4. Market Surveillance Even after obtaining CE certification, manufacturers must continuously monitor their products to maintain compliance with standards. Regular audits may be conducted to ensure ongoing adherence to safety and quality requirements.


Conclusion


The CE certification of gabion fences is essential for ensuring that these products meet the required quality and safety standards in the European market. By adhering to the CE marking process, manufacturers can provide consumers with reliable, safe, and sustainable fence solutions that satisfy both aesthetic and functional needs. As the demand for innovative and environmentally friendly building materials continues to grow, CE certification will undoubtedly remain a vital aspect of the production and installation of gabion fences in Europe.
